Common Door Handle Problems
Before delving into options, it's important to develop a list of common issues that property owners may face with door handles:
Sticking or Jammed Handle: The handle might not turn efficiently or might feel stuck.Loose Handle: A handle that wobbles or feels loose can be bothersome and might show a hidden concern.Non-Functioning Lock Mechanism: The handle may turn, but the locking mechanism does not engage.Misaligned Door: If the handle is hard to run, the door itself may be misaligned.Broken or Cracked Handle: Physical damage to the handle can render it ineffective.Rust or Corrosion: Especially in exterior doors, rust can restrain functionality.Troubleshooting Solutions1. Sticking or Jammed Handle
A sticking or jammed handle can frequently be solved with a little bit of maintenance. Here's what to do:
Inspect and Clean: Remove any noticeable particles or dirt around the handle and lock location. Use a cleaner and a soft fabric.Oil: Apply a silicone spray or a graphite lubricant to the handle's moving parts. Prevent utilizing oil-based products, as they can bring in dirt and cause additional sticking.Tighten Screws: Sometimes, the screws that hold the handle in location might have loosened up, causing friction. Tightening them can often deal with the problem.2. Loose Handle
A loose handle can easily be tightened. Here's how you can approach this:
Locate the Screws: Most handles are secured with screws concealed below ornamental caps. Get rid of any caps and check for screws.Tighten Screws: Use a screwdriver to secure the screws, guaranteeing they are snug however not extremely tight, which could cause breaking.Change: If the handle stays loose, think about replacing it, as worn-out parts may no longer hold safely.3. Non-Functioning Lock Mechanism
If the handle turns however does not engage the lock, follow these steps:
Inspect the Lock Cylinder: Sometimes the lock cylinder can get jammed. Eliminate the cylinder and analyze it for particles or damage. Cleaning may be necessary.Inspect Alignment: Ensure that the lock aligns properly with the strike plate. If misalignment takes place, adjust the strike plate or the lock.Lubrication: Apply lubricant to the locking mechanism to lower friction.4. Misaligned Door
A misaligned door handle fixer near me can cause issues with handle operation. Resolve it as follows:
Examine Hinge Screws: Look for loose screws on the hinges. Tightening these can help realign the door handle fixer.Use a Shim: If the alignment issue persists, installing shims can assist readjust the door's position within the frame.Professional Help: If the door remains misaligned, it may be best to speak with a professional door handle repair, as it may suggest structural issues.5. Broken or Cracked Handle
A physical break or crack requires replacement. Here's how to handle this:
Remove the Broken Handle: Unscrew and get rid of the damaged handle.Select a Replacement: Visit a local hardware shop or search online to find an ideal replacement handle.Install the New Handle: Follow the manufacturer's instructions to install the brand-new handle effectively.6. Rust or Corrosion
Handling rust requires diligence in repair. Here's a guide:
Remove Rust: Use a wire brush or sandpaper to scrub away any rust from the handle. Take care not to damage the surface area.Tidy and Protect: Once rust is eliminated, clean the area and use a rust-inhibiting spray or paint to avoid future occurrences.Think about Replacement: If the handle is substantially rusted, replacement might be essential.Frequently asked questions
Q1: How typically should I carry out maintenance on my door handles?A: Regular
maintenance every six months can assist avoid many common issues. Cleaning up and oiling handles must belong to this regimen.

Q2: What kind of lubricant should I use?A: Silicone spray or graphite lube is best. Prevent oil-based products as they can attract dirt.

Q3: Can I change the door handle myself?A: Yes! The majority of door handle replacements are straightforward and can be handled by a house owner with standard tools. Q4: What if the issue continues after troubleshooting?A: If issues remain unsolved, consider contacting a professional locksmith professional or door technician for further help.
